What does live trapping cost?
Trapping in Hialeah is often billed per visit or per animal, commonly $75 to $150 each in published ranges, plus a setup fee. A family of four squirrels over a week can add several hundred dollars to a Hialeah job.
How much does one-way door exclusion cost?
Typical published ranges put one-way door installation in Hialeah at $250 to $600, including the return trip to remove it and seal the hole. That assumes secondary holes are priced separately. It is usually the most cost-effective removal method for Hialeah homes.

Why do quotes vary so much?
The main reasons in Hialeah are hole count, roof pitch, and whether young are present. A steep two-story Hialeah roof with six holes needs far more labor than a ranch with one. Some Hialeah companies bundle cleanup; others price it separately.

How long does squirrel removal take?
Most Hialeah homeowners are squirrel-free within ten days of the first visit. The door needs a few days to work. If traps are used instead, expect daily checks in Hialeah for up to a week. Sealing is usually finished the same day the door comes down.
Should I replace attic insulation after squirrels?
It depends on how long they stayed. A brief visit to a Hialeah attic might need only spot cleanup. Months of nesting leave urine, droppings, and tunnels that cut insulation performance in a Hialeah attic. A Hialeah provider can assess the damage and price replacement for just the affected area.
